Q. Describe about Carbon Steel?
Steel having no specified minimum quantity for any alloying element (other than commonly accepted amounts of manganese, silicon, and copper) and containing only an incidental amount of any element other than carbon, silicon, copper, sulphur, and phosphorous. Steel, containing traces of vanadium or columbium, added to increase the strength, shall be considered carbon steel.
